import mock
|
|
|
|
from nova import test
|
|
from nova.virt.hyperv import networkutils
|
|
from nova.virt.hyperv import vmutils
|
|
|
|
|
|
class NetworkUtilsTestCase(test.NoDBTestCase):
|
|
"""Unit tests for the Hyper-V NetworkUtils class."""
|
|
|
|
_FAKE_PORT = {'Name': mock.sentinel.FAKE_PORT_NAME}
|
|
_FAKE_RET_VALUE = 0
|
|
|
|
_MSVM_VIRTUAL_SWITCH = 'Msvm_VirtualSwitch'
|
|
|
|
def setUp(self):
|
|
self._networkutils = networkutils.NetworkUtils()
|
|
self._networkutils._conn = mock.MagicMock()
|
|
|
|
super(NetworkUtilsTestCase, self).setUp()
|
|
|
|
def test_get_external_vswitch(self):
|
|
mock_vswitch = mock.MagicMock()
|
|
mock_vswitch.path_.return_value = mock.sentinel.FAKE_VSWITCH_PATH
|
|
getattr(self._networkutils._conn,
|
|
self._MSVM_VIRTUAL_SWITCH).return_value = [mock_vswitch]
|
|
|
|
switch_path = self._networkutils.get_external_vswitch(
|
|
mock.sentinel.FAKE_VSWITCH_NAME)
|
|
|
|
self.assertEqual(mock.sentinel.FAKE_VSWITCH_PATH, switch_path)
|
|
|
|
def test_get_external_vswitch_not_found(self):
|
|
self._networkutils._conn.Msvm_VirtualEthernetSwitch.return_value = []
|
|
|
|
self.assertRaises(vmutils.HyperVException,
|
|
self._networkutils.get_external_vswitch,
|
|
mock.sentinel.FAKE_VSWITCH_NAME)
|
|
|
|
def test_get_external_vswitch_no_name(self):
|
|
mock_vswitch = mock.MagicMock()
|
|
mock_vswitch.path_.return_value = mock.sentinel.FAKE_VSWITCH_PATH
|
|
|
|
mock_ext_port = self._networkutils._conn.Msvm_ExternalEthernetPort()[0]
|
|
self._prepare_external_port(mock_vswitch, mock_ext_port)
|
|
|
|
switch_path = self._networkutils.get_external_vswitch(None)
|
|
self.assertEqual(mock.sentinel.FAKE_VSWITCH_PATH, switch_path)
|
|
|
|
def _prepare_external_port(self, mock_vswitch, mock_ext_port):
|
|
mock_lep = mock_ext_port.associators()[0]
|
|
mock_lep.associators.return_value = [mock_vswitch]
|
|
|
|
def test_create_vswitch_port(self):
|
|
svc = self._networkutils._conn.Msvm_VirtualSwitchManagementService()[0]
|
|
svc.CreateSwitchPort.return_value = (
|
|
self._FAKE_PORT, self._FAKE_RET_VALUE)
|
|
|
|
port = self._networkutils.create_vswitch_port(
|
|
mock.sentinel.FAKE_VSWITCH_PATH, mock.sentinel.FAKE_PORT_NAME)
|
|
|
|
svc.CreateSwitchPort.assert_called_once_with(
|
|
Name=mock.ANY, FriendlyName=mock.sentinel.FAKE_PORT_NAME,
|
|
ScopeOfResidence="", VirtualSwitch=mock.sentinel.FAKE_VSWITCH_PATH)
|
|
self.assertEqual(self._FAKE_PORT, port)
|
|
|
|
def test_vswitch_port_needed(self):
|
|
self.assertTrue(self._networkutils.vswitch_port_needed())
